Synthesis of near-IR fluorescent oxazine dyes with esterase-labile sulfonate esters.

机构信息

Department of Biochemistry and Molecular Pharmacology, University of Massachusetts Medical School, Worcester, Massachusetts 01655, USA.

出版信息

Org Lett. 2011 Dec 2;13(23):6196-9. doi: 10.1021/ol202619f. Epub 2011 Nov 2.

Abstract

Near-IR oxazine dyes are reported that contain sulfonate esters which are rapidly cleaved by esterase activity to unmask highly polar anionic sulfonates. Strategies for the synthesis of these dyes included the development of milder dye condensation conditions with improved functional compatibility and the use of an alkyl halide that allows for the introduction of esterase-labile sulfonates without the need for sulfonation of the target molecule.
